Crispy Fried Onion Mac and Cheese
Mac and cheese is pure magic—cozy, creamy, and endlessly versatile. But this Crispy Fried Onion Mac and Cheese takes things to a whole new level. Picture tender pasta coated in a luscious sauce made with Gouda, Swiss, and Gruyère cheeses, topped with crispy fried onions and Parmesan for the perfect balance of creaminess and crunch. It’s comfort food with a unique twist.
What makes this recipe stand out is how the flavors and textures come together so perfectly. The Gouda, Swiss, and Gruyère blend into a rich, complex cheese sauce with buttery sweetness, nutty undertones, and bold savory depth. The sauce clings to every piece of pasta, making each bite irresistible. And then there’s the topping—crispy fried onions and Parmesan add an amazing crunch and bold flavor that bring the whole dish to life. A touch of Dijon mustard and smoked paprika adds subtle tang and warmth, giving the dish just the right amount of spice.
The secret to perfect mac and cheese is in the details. Choosing pasta that holds onto the sauce—like elbow macaroni, cavatappi, or shells—makes all the difference. And don’t skip making the roux; the butter and flour base ensures the cheese sauce stays silky smooth. Baking it creates a bubbly, golden crust that’s worth the extra step.
While this dish is satisfying on its own, it pairs wonderfully with a crisp green salad or roasted veggies like broccoli or Brussels sprouts to balance the richness. Feeling indulgent? Serve it alongside garlic bread. It’s also easy to customize—try mixing in bacon, caramelized onions, or sautéed mushrooms for a heartier version.
Whether you’re making it for a potluck, family dinner, or a cozy night in, this Crispy Fried Onion Mac and Cheese is practical and delicious. Assemble it ahead of time, pop it in the oven when ready, and enjoy a dish that’s sure to impress. With its creamy sauce and crunchy topping, this mac and cheese will quickly become a favorite in your kitchen.
Crispy Fried Onion Mac and Cheese
Ingredients
- 12 oz elbow macaroni (or pasta of choice)
- 2 tbsp unsalted butter
- 2 tbsp all-purpose flour
- 2 cups whole milk
- ¾ cup shredded Gouda cheese
- ¾ cup shredded Swiss cheese
- ¾ cup shredded Gruyère cheese
- ½ tsp Dijon mustard
- ¼ tsp smoked paprika (optional)
- Salt and pepper, to taste
- 1 cup crispy fried onions
- 2 tbsp grated Parmesan cheese
Instructions
- Bring a large pot of salted water to a boil. Cook the macaroni until al dente according to the package instructions. Drain and set aside.
- In a large saucepan, melt the butter over medium heat. Stir in the flour and cook for 1-2 minutes, whisking constantly, to form a roux.
- Gradually pour in the whole milk, whisking to combine. Bring to a gentle simmer and cook until the mixture thickens slightly, about 3-5 minutes.
- Reduce the heat to low and add the Gouda, Swiss, and Gruyère cheeses in batches, stirring until smooth.
- Stir in the Dijon mustard and smoked paprika, and season with salt and pepper to taste.
- Add the cooked macaroni to the cheese sauce and stir to coat the pasta evenly.
- In a small bowl, combine the crispy fried onions and Parmesan cheese.
- Preheat your oven to 375°F.
- Transfer the mac and cheese to a greased 9x13-inch baking dish. Sprinkle the fried onion mixture evenly over the top.
- Bake for 15-20 minutes, or until the topping is golden brown and crispy.
- Remove from the oven and let cool slightly before serving.